
This project, supported by a District Assistance Program (DAP) Grant, will create a safe and welcoming space for therapy rabbits used in animal-assisted therapy for foster children. Central Texas Table of Grace provides emergency shelter and transitional care for children in the foster system—young people who often carry the weight of trauma, uncertainty, and loss. By helping care for therapy animals, these children gain comfort, trust, and emotional healing—small but powerful steps toward confidence and independence.
